Output f7e6a6f4bf5f45e4569581864ca42a4332348d031b8ee4e28d5bb98df72c6868:184

value
10389982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22b57eb55ba65590d39dbac197a3dc902b7afcab OP_EQUAL
address
34rYKZEQHGEiTrPtFU7QreZM9hxTLK9Ze3
transaction
f7e6a6f4bf5f45e4569581864ca42a4332348d031b8ee4e28d5bb98df72c6868
confirmations
339571
spent
true